Camera: Avoid stream re-configuration when format gets overridden

It is allowed and expected some stream formats to get overriden
by the Hal implementation. In such cases the original format should
be stored and made available to device clients.

@@ -142,12 +142,32 @@ class CameraDeviceBase : public virtual RefBase {
    virtual status_t createInputStream(uint32_t width, uint32_t height,
            int32_t format, /*out*/ int32_t *id) = 0;

    struct StreamInfo {
        uint32_t width;
        uint32_t height;
        uint32_t format;
        bool formatOverridden;
        uint32_t originalFormat;
        android_dataspace dataSpace;
        StreamInfo() : width(0), height(0), format(0), formatOverridden(false), originalFormat(0),
                dataSpace(HAL_DATASPACE_UNKNOWN) {}
        /**
         * Check whether the format matches the current or the original one in case
         * it got overridden.
         */
        bool matchFormat(uint32_t clientFormat) {
            if ((formatOverridden && (originalFormat == clientFormat)) ||
                    (format == clientFormat)) {
                return true;
            }
            return false;
        }
    };

    /**
     * Get information about a given stream.
     */
    virtual status_t getStreamInfo(int id,
            uint32_t *width, uint32_t *height,
            uint32_t *format, android_dataspace *dataSpace) = 0;
    virtual status_t getStreamInfo(int id, StreamInfo *streamInfo) = 0;
